Overview
PBSS4021SPN,115 from Nexperia is a dual NPN/PNP low VCE(sat) Breakthrough In Small Signal (BISS) transistor in SOT96-1 (SO8) package, rated for 20 V VCEO, 7.5 A NPN and −6.3 A PNP continuous collector current, with typical RCE(sat) of 25 mΩ (NPN) and 36 mΩ (PNP) at 5 A/−5 A. It serves as a high-efficiency power switch in battery-driven motor control and charging circuits.

Technical Context
This device integrates two independent BISS transistors - TR1 (NPN) and TR2 (PNP) - sharing no internal connection, enabling fully decoupled high-side and low-side switching. Each transistor features optimized base doping and epitaxial layer design to achieve ultra-low saturation resistance while maintaining high hFE (550 typ. at 500 mA for NPN; 400 typ. at −500 mA for PNP).
Switching performance is characterized by fast turn-on (ton = 80 ns NPN, 95 ns PNP) and controlled storage time (ts = 650 ns NPN, 340 ns PNP), supporting PWM frequencies up to 10 MHz in DC-DC and motor drive applications. Thermal resistance is specified per transistor (Rth(j-a) = 170 K/W on FR4 standard footprint) and per device (Rth(j-a) = 145 K/W).
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VCEO | 20 V (NPN), −20 V (PNP): Maximum safe blocking voltage across collector-emitter with base open. |
| IC | 7.5 A (NPN), −6.3 A (PNP): Continuous DC collector current rating under Tamb ≤25 °C with defined PCB mounting. |
| RCE(sat) | 25–35 mΩ (NPN), 36–54 mΩ (PNP) at IC = ±5 A / IB = ±0.5 A: Directly determines conduction loss and junction temperature rise in high-current switches. |
| hFE | 300–550 (NPN), 250–400 (PNP) at IC = ±500 mA: Enables low base drive current requirements for efficient gate driving in discrete H-bridge stages. |
| toff | 725 ns (NPN), 425 ns (PNP): Total turn-off delay + fall time; critical for minimizing shoot-through risk in synchronous rectification. |
| fT | 115 MHz (NPN), 105 MHz (PNP): Transition frequency confirming suitability for RF-coupled bias networks and high-speed switching control loops. |
| Ptot | 0.86 W (per device, FR4 standard footprint): Total dissipation limit defining maximum simultaneous power handling before thermal shutdown. |
Pinout & Package
SOT96-1 (SO8) is an 8-lead, 3.9 mm body-width surface-mount plastic package with gull-wing leads, optimized for medium-power thermal dissipation on FR4 PCBs. Pin 1 is index-marked; leads are spaced at 1.27 mm pitch.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Emitter (TR1, NPN) | Low-side return path for NPN transistor; connects to ground or low-voltage rail in half-bridge configurations. |
| 2 | Base (TR1, NPN) | Control input for NPN switch; requires ~0.5 A peak drive for full saturation at 7.5 A load. |
| 3 | Emitter (TR2, PNP) | High-side return path for PNP transistor; ties to load or positive rail in high-side switch topologies. |
| 4 | Base (TR2, PNP) | Inverted control input for PNP switch; negative current injection enables sourcing capability up to −6.3 A. |
| 5, 6 | Collector (TR2, PNP) | Power output terminal for PNP; paralleled pins reduce current density and thermal resistance in high-current paths. |
| 7, 8 | Collector (TR1, NPN) | Power output terminal for NPN; dual-collector layout supports 7.5 A continuous conduction with <275 mV VCE(sat). |

FAQ
What is the maximum allowable base current for continuous operation?
The absolute maximum base current is 1 A per transistor (Table 6). For reliable continuous operation at full collector current, IB = 0.375 A (NPN) and IB = −0.325 A (PNP) are recommended per datasheet Fig 9/17, ensuring VCE(sat) remains within 275 mV/−350 mV limits without thermal runaway.
Can PBSS4021SPN,115 be used in linear regulator applications?
No. Its RCE(sat) is optimized for saturated switching, not linear operation. At VCE = 2 V and IC = 5 A, power dissipation exceeds 10 W-far above the 0.86 W Ptot rating. Linear use would cause immediate thermal failure.
How does the dual-collector pin configuration affect PCB layout?
Pins 5–6 (PNP collector) and 7–8 (NPN collector) must be routed to separate high-current copper pours with ≥1 cm² area each, as specified in Table 6 footnote [2]. This reduces thermal resistance by 35% versus single-pin routing and prevents localized heating at solder joints.
